There's a pride in representing your country on a stage like the sport of wrestling, which I've done since I was five years old. There's nothing that can deter me other than my own decision to leave the sport.
Jordan Burroughs
ShareWTF𝕏

Interpretation

What this quote means

Representing one's country in sports instills pride and determination.

In this quote, Jordan Burroughs emphasizes the deep sense of pride that comes from competing for one's country in wrestling, a sport he has passionately engaged in since childhood. He highlights that the only factor that could drive him away from the sport is his own choice, suggesting a strong commitment to his athletic career and national representation.
